Answer to Question 1

D
When designing educational offerings, it is important to structure the objectives around the goals for
the offering. Two objectives are used to support the goals of the program/initiative. They are terminal
objectives (identifies the major behavior that contributes to the achievement of the overall goal) and
enabling objectives (identifies a secondary behavior that enables/contributes to the achievement of the
terminal goal).
